BTW I should also mention that "localhost" is the 
same as 127.0.0.1, so that won't work on your PSP 
either, but will work fine on the computer running 
SlimServer.

> You should use your SlimServer IP address as given 
> to your SlimServer by the router, not your public 
> IP.  On a Windows SlimServer computer, open a 
> command prompt and type "ipconfig" to get its IP 
> address.
> 
> Also 127.0.0.1 won't work, it's a loopback 
> interface which redirects the machine back to 
> itself.  Therefore it will work for the machine 
> running SlimServer (i.e. looped back to itself) 
> but it will not work for any other networked 
> machine, since it will try to reference itself 
> rather than SlimServer.
> 
> I assume your PSP is associated with your own 
> router.  If it isn't, it's trying to access your 
> SlimServer from the Internet.  In your router, you 
> will need to port-forward ports 9000 TCP and 3483 
> TCP/UDP for the SlimServer computer, so that from 
> the Internet, your public IP address will resolve 
> to the SlimServer's IP address with those ports 
> open.  Note that this is inherently insecure 
> though.  Follow this thread:
